Security forces eliminate 34 terrorists in KP, Balochistan IBO’s: ISPR

26 Fitna Al Khwarij terrorists killed in KP; eight Fitna Al Hindustan members killed in Balochistan

Security forces have killed 34 terrorists belonging to the banned Fitna Al Khwarij and Fitna Al Hindustan militant groups in separate Intelligence Based Operations (IBO) in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a and Balochistan, the military’s media wing said on Wednesday.

In a statement, the Inter-Services Public Relations (ISPR) said security forces carried out a series of “high-tempo, intelligence-driven operations” as part of a counter-terrorism campaign aimed at eliminating the “Indian proxies”.

The state uses the term Fitna Al Khwarij for terrorists associated with the outlawed Tehreek-i-Taliban Pakistan, while Fitna Al Hindustan refers to outlawed outfits operating in Balochistan.

According to the statement, 26 terrorists must belong Fitna Al Khwarij were killed in four separate engagements in KP while eight terrorists attached to Fitna Al Hindustan was killed during an operation in Balochistan on Tuesday.

The ISPR said that the movement of a group of terrorists who were trying to infiltrate through the Pakistan-Afghanistan border in the general area of ​​Hassan Khel, North Waziristan district, was detected by security forces. Troops engaged the group and killed one terrorist, adding that the slain member was identified as an Afghan national.

In a separate IBO in Lakki Marwat district, three terrorists were killed after an intense exchange of fire, the statement said.

Simultaneously, security forces carried out two engagements in the general area of ​​Narmi Khel in Bannu district in which 10 terrorists were killed. In another operation in Mir Ali area of ​​North Waziristan, 12 terrorists were eliminated based on accurate intelligence, ISPR added.

During a fifth engagement in Sambaza area of ​​Zhob district, eight terrorists belonging Fitna Al Hindustan was killed after a fierce exchange of fire.

“Arms and ammunition were also recovered from Indian-sponsored slain khwarij and terrorists who remained actively involved in several terrorist activities in the area,” it said.

The ISPR said clearance operations were underway to eliminate any remaining terrorists. It reiterated that security forces, along with law enforcement agencies, would continue operations under the vision of “Azm-i-Istehkam”, endorsed by the Federal Apex Committee on the National Action Plan, to eradicate foreign sponsored terrorism from the country.

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if hailed the security forces for their successful operations.

“With professional expertise and strategic precision, the security forces eliminated 26 terrorists Fitna al-Khawarij in KP and eight terrorists of Fitna al-Hindustan in Balochistan during several operations,” he said.

He said that the armed forces of Pakistan continued to achieve decisive successes against terrorist organizations.

“Under the vision of Azm-e-Istehkam, terrorism will soon be eradicated from the country,” the prime minister said, adding that the government remained determined to ensure complete elimination of terrorism from the nation.
